Can anyone tell me how you go about sending a package home from DIsneyworld? Is there a location that does a general UPS shipments?

Have you ever picked up an extra suitcase from one of the outlet stores and used it to bring home the extra Disney suplys? graemlins/mickey.gif

When we were Honeymooning in 2001 every store in Downtown Disney would ship purchases for you via UPS - we used that service and everything went fine
Don't recall if the shops in the Parks ships as well but I think they do

Last November I had several purchases UPS back to my house. It worked out great. Another thing we have done in the past is to pack an empty suitcase inside a larger suitcase when you are going down. Then you have an extra one to fill up with your new treasures. The price for luggage that I have seen at WDW is outrageous.

If you want to ship items via UPS, that is items not purchased in WDW stores, there a place in the Premium Outlets that does UPS shipping. The outlets are just off property and can be accessed off Vineland-Apopka Road or International Drive South. Keep in mind they are a little expensive. If you have a car, there is a regular UPS facility on Orange Blossum Trail that charges the actual UPS rate without any markup. You can get the actual address off UPS website.
Both places can provide packaging if needed for a fee.
